Virgin Bitcoin refers to Bitcoins that have not been spent or circulated since their creation as a reward from mining. These coins have no transaction history, making them a pristine addition to the blockchain and the cryptocurrency market.
Virgin Bitcoins are essentially new Bitcoins that are awarded to miners for verifying transactions and adding them to the blockchain. When a miner successfully solves a cryptographic puzzle, they are allowed to add a new block of transactions to the blockchain. As a reward for this work, they receive bitcoins, which at the point of generation are considered ‘virgin’ because they have not yet been used in any transaction other than the award for mining. This attribute makes them distinct within the digital currency space.
Virgin Bitcoins hold a unique position in the cryptocurrency world. Their untouched status means they carry no history of transactions, making them particularly attractive to certain investors and buyers who may prefer coins without a traceable past. This can be due to concerns over privacy, the desire to avoid coins previously involved in illicit activities, or simply the preference for holding coins that are in a ‘mint’ state.
The process of creating Virgin Bitcoins is straightforward, intrinsic to the Bitcoin blockchain’s operation:
1. Miners use powerful computers to solve complex mathematical problems.
2. The first miner to solve the problem gets to add a new block to the blockchain.
3. The network then rewards the miner with newly minted Bitcoins.
4. These newly minted Bitcoins are considered ‘virgin’ because they have not been involved in any previous transactions.
